b) A square footing 3.5 m X 3.5 m is built on a homogeneous bed of sand of density 16 kN/m having an angle of shearing resistance of 36°. The depth of foundation is 3 m below the ground surface. Calculate the safe load that can be applied on the footing with a factor of safety of 3 Take bearing capacity factors as N= 27, Nq = 30, Ny = 35
